Centralized Vault not accessible from Windows 2008 Server? Fine from other 2003 servers?

Thread needs solution

I've got the agent installed and can manage the remote 2008 server within the management console, however attempts to set up a backup plan to a centralized vault are not possible. Essentially, despite there being centralized vaults created, they are not visible from the 2008 box. There's just nothing in there...

Am i missing the obvious...the central vaults and backup plans are all set up and working fine for all other 2003 servers, its just this 2008 box isn't playing nicely.

hoping for some help...thanx in advnace!

Version: Acronis Backup and Recovery 10 Advanced Server (Build 10.0.11345)

On the computer with Acronis Agent installed please restart Acronis services:

* Go to Start -> Run -> services.msc

* Right-click on the following Acronis services, and click on Restart:

- Acronis Managed Machine Service;

- Acronis Remote Agent;

- Acronis Scheduler2 Service.

A possible cause is that DNS name of the networked machine with the vault was not registered correctly. To resolve the issue please delete the present unaccessible vault and recreate it specifying the IP address at  the Path box. 

If nothing helps, please obtain AcronisInfo file and attach to your next post:

- Download AcronisInfo file ;
- Run the downloaded file. The gathered information will be put in AcronisInfo.zip in the same folder, where the AcronisInfo was saved.

Running AcronisInfo may take up to 5 minutes.
